Khia Slams Sexyy Red & Sukihana Comparisons: “These Hoes Were Raised By Trina…They Won’t Be Here in 25 Years [Like Me]”

Published: Wednesday 25th Oct 2023 by Rashad

Khia may be known for spitting some of Rap history’s raciest bars, but that doesn’t mean she enjoys being compared to other female rappers who have done the same.

Having made no secret of her distaste for some of the genre’s newer stars, the 46-year-old has slammed the likes of Cardi B, Megan Thee Stallion, Saweetie, Latto, and others over the years for various reasons.

And while veterans like Lil Kim, Da Brat, Trina, and Nicki Minaj have long felt royal tongue lashings from the self-proclaimed Queen of the South’s criticisms across her streaming platforms, she recently added relative newcomers Sukihana and Sexyy Red to the list of recipients.

See what she said that has the ‘Hood Rats’ hitmakers’ fans in a tizzy.

Taking to her popular Web series ‘Khia’s Gag Order‘ earlier this week, the rapstress (born Khia Chambers) unlocked ferocious commentary about Sexyy Red and Sukihana.

“These hoes were raised by Trina,” she said before elaborating on why she was tired of the comparisons (as seen in the video above).

Alluding to their controversial hits ‘Pound Town‘ and ‘Eating‘ respectively, Chambers made clear her material – though raunchy – never reached the limits of Red or Suki’s.

“It ain’t ‘eat no n*ggas a**’ or ‘suck no n*ggas toes,'” she said. “Y’all hoes couldn’t have grown up listening to me because that’s not how the f*ck I roll.”

Going on to slam Sexyy’s recently leaked sex tape and more, Khia begged viewers to stop referring to her as the original versions of the two hitmakers as she believes they likely won’t be able to boast her career longevity.

“I’m still eating off of all [my old] hits; at the end of the day where do you think these hoes will be when they get 50,” she inquired. “They won’t be sitting up here looking like me…they’re not even going to be here in 25 years let alone those tired a** songs they putting out.”
